- Q3464268 abstract "Sainte-Foy–Sillery is a former borough of Quebec City (Population (2006): 72,262). It comprised the former city of Sillery and most of Sainte-Foy, which were incorporated into the borough on January 1, 2002.On November 1, 2009, the new borough of Sainte-Foy–Sillery–Cap-Rouge was created, including the area of the former city of Cap-Rouge and the part of Sainte-Foy that had not been incorporated earlier into the former borough; these had been incorporated into the borough of Laurentien in 2002. In the 2009 reorganization, Laurentien was dismembered and ceased to exist.".
